Here are ten embarrassing facts about the chained CPI, which the White House and its defenders would prefer to see overlooked: 1. Of course it's a benefit cut. Chained CPI defenders say it's not a benefit cut, just a slowdown in the rate of the benefit's planned increases. That's a silly semantic game, unworthy of serious leaders or analysts. The Social Security benefit, as laid out on the Social Security Administration's website, includes adjustments designed to keep pace with the rising cost of living. Those adjustments are not a benefit increase. They are designed to prevent the benefit from being decreased as a result of inflation, If you lower that adjustment, you are cutting benefits, Period. 2. Of course it's a tax hike. Same goes for the tax impact of the chained CPI. Our tax brackets were designed to make sure that people who were not earning more in real dollars, which includes many, if not most of the 99 percent were not hit with an unearned tax hike. The president has repeatedly promised, that there will be no middle class tax hikes, while he is President. If you substitute the chained CPI for the current formula, as the President has proposed, people will be kicked into higher tax brackets earlier. Then they will pay more in taxes, even if they are not making any more real money. That is a tax hike. 3. And it is a tax hike for everyone but the wealthy. In fact, it is a tax hike for everyone but the wealthy. In fact, it is a tax hike on all but the highest levels of income. The richest earners will not be affected, because they are already in the highest tax bracket. Got it? So it is a tax hike on everyone, except the richest among us. Actually, it is a tax hike for them too, but only on their lower levels of income. The richer you are, the less you will see in a tax rate increase. 4. You could save much more money in other, better ways. The White House has said the chained CPI will save $122 billion in benefits over ten years. Leaving aside the fact that Social Security does not affect the deficit, here is what is not being done: Close capital gains loopholes: $174 billion. End the Bush tax cuts at Obama's original $250,000 level, rather than the compromise $400,000 number: $183 billion. Cut overseas military bases by 20 percent: $200 billion. Negotiate with drug companies: $220 billion. Enact Defense friendly Pentagon cuts: $519 billion. End corporate tax loopholes,, as the President is proposing: $1.24 trillion. Faced with those numbers, the chained CPI benefit cut is embarrassing.

Geography beats politics, well, almost always. One could even say that money beats politics, but these two are too linked for this statement to make much sense. Since the opening statement is almost always true, let's begin with an odd geographical feature named the Beit Shean Valley. The Jordan River runs from west to east, from the Mediterranean Sea to the Jordan Valley. The area where these valleys meet, is misleadingly called Beit Shean Valley. Since the Jezreel Valley is higher than the Jordan one, they meet in a series of dramatic cliffs and several steps. The widest step forms the bulk of the Beit Shean Valley, the area next to the river, is known as Zor. This is the site of what nowadays is called the Jordan River Border Crossing, and in the past the Sheikh Hussein Bridge. It is the main access point between Jordan and Israel. Few people alive remember the Sheikh Hussein Bridge. It was blown up by the Palmah First Battalion of the Haganah on June 16, 1946. This event was part of a massive terror operation known as The Night of the Bridges, during which nine bridges were destroyed. In two bridges the operation failed. Three others were spared by the political level behind the operation. It is one of the few actions committed by the Jewish Resistance Movement, an ad hoc alliance between the Hagana, Etzel and Lehi. This event, combined with the attack on the King David Hotel, led to the dismantlement of the JRM. After that, the road between Beit Shean and Irbid, a principal city and crossroads in Jordan, was cut until 1994, when the Peace Agreement between Jordan and Israel, led to the construction of a new bridge. A fact telling a lot about Israel, is that its side of the facility is administered by the Israel Airport Authority. The closest thing to an airplane passing through the area, are massive amounts of birds, during their seasonal migrations between Africa and Europe. Simply, this is the most proficient organization dealing with high security cross points. Judah Maccabee is said to have used the bridge in the 2nd Century BC. In 63BC, Roman Emperor Pompey, used this bridge to reach Beit Shean. In 638 AD, the Muslims used it to conquer the Holy Land. Simply, the cross offers a unique access to the coastal plains. Nowadays, it provides the Kingdom of Jordan with a valuable access to the Mediterranean Sea. Despite their unwillingness to admit that, Israel and Jordan are extremely close.

Here's the real news, as US corporations rake in the profits, and shift record amounts of money into offshore tax havens, nearly half a million workers "disappeared" last month. Yes, disappeared. The Labor Department tracks what it calls the labor force participation rate, wonk speak for the percentage of people working, or actively hunting for a job. In March, that number slumped to 63.3%, the lowest point since 1979. That means there are millions of people out there, who have lost their jobs, stopped interviewing or even applying, who have packed it in, given up. The government excludes them, when it calculates the main unemployment rate. They have entered the invisible work force. The unemployment rate ticked down from 7.7% to 7.6% in March. Some might cheer that news. Don't. The jobless rate didn't dip because the economy improved, it dipped because the government simply stopped counting a half million out of work people as out of work. Lawrence Davidson: Why Americans Are So Ignorant!

It's not only Fox News, there are some understandable reasons for it, In 2008, Rick Shenkman, the Editor in Chief of the History News Network, published a book titled Just How Stupid Are We? Facing the Truth about the American Voter. In it he demonstrated, among other things, that most Americans were: (1) ignorant about major international events, (2) knew little about how their own government runs, and who runs it, (3) were nonetheless wiling to accept government positions and policies, even though a moderate amount of critical thought suggested they were bad for the country, and (4) were readily swayed by stereotyping simplistic solutions, irrational fears, and public relations babble. Shenkman spent 256 pages documenting these claims, using a great number of polls and surveys from very reputable sources. Indeed, in the end it is hard to argue with his data. So, what can we say about this? One thing that can be said, is that this is not an abnormal state of affairs. As has been suggested in prior analyses, ignorance of non local affairs, often leading to inaccurate assumptions, passive acceptance of authority, and illogical actions is, in fact, a default position for any population. To put it another way, the majority of any population will pay little or no attention to news stories, or government actions, that do not appear to impact their lives, or the lives of close associates. If something non local happens, that is brought to their attention by the media, they will passively accept government explanations and simplistic solutions. The primary issue is, does it impact my life? If it does, people will pay attention. If it appears not to, they won't pay attention. For instance, in Shenkman's book unfavorable comparisons are sometimes made between Americans and Europeans. Americans often are said to be much more ignorant about world geography than are Europeans. This might be, but it is, ironically, due to an accident of geography. Americans occupy a large subcontinent isolated by two oceans. Europeans are crowded into small, contiguous countries that, until recently, repeatedly invaded each other, as well as possessed overseas colonies. Under these circumstances, a knowledge of geography, as well as paying attention to what is happening on the other side of the border, has more immediate relevance to the lives of those in Toulouse or Amsterdam, than is the case for someone in Pittsburgh or Topeka. If conditions were reversed, Europeans would know less geography, and Americans more.

While doing research for this article, I began to review some old textbooks from my teaching days, and happened across a theory, initially developed by some sociologists, to explain why and how crime exists: the Social Control Theory. The fundamental underpinnings of the Social Control Theory. The fundamental underpinnings of the Social Control Theory, are that the inclination towards deviance, meaning nonconformity to social norms and crime, is actually a normal part of human nature, consequently crime prevention programs should not focus on why some people become criminals, but instead on why others do not. Critics of the Social Control Theory, contend that its almost fatalistic embrace of biological determinism, not only undermines the concept of free will, it also fails to explain, why people often feel guilty or remorse, after committing antisocial or criminal acts. In response, Social Control theorists argue that, while guilt and remorse may indeed be present during early stages of criminal activity, human beings have a remarkable and, as this article contends, dangerous ability to neutralize any guilt they feel about their wrong doings through the use of rationalizations. Soon I began to realize that the Social Control Theory supports a maxim of mine, that I've frequently proffered in many Pravda Ru articles over the past ten years: Human nature is basically inclined towards evil. Therefore most of the world's conflicts are not caused by clashes between good and evil, but between what degrees of evil are considered to be acceptable, and what degrees are not. There is some historical evidence to support this maxim. America's founding fathers, having fought and won a war against a monarchy, saw how easily evil can manifest, when too much power is concentrated into too few hands. Thus they created a government with three branches, legislative, executive, and judicial in the hope that each branch would check and balance the power of the others. By contrast, theoretical communism was created, on the belief that human nature was basically good, that people would be willing to labor not for their own benefit, but for the betterment of humanity as a whole. That human beings will act communally, and share their resources, would be based on one's need, instead of one's abilities. Logic naturally dictates, that if human beings are fundamentally good, no check and balance system is required. The result is that communist regimes, or perhaps more accurately, regimes that claimed to be communist, produced some of history's worst dictators.
